Paul Mason is an analyst at E&P who provides insights into the corporate dynamics of companies like WiseTech Global. He recently commented on the aftermath of the board exodus at WiseTech, suggesting that while the departure of independent directors might resolve fears about founder Richard White being ousted, it creates urgent challenges in governance and investor confidence, as the company relies heavily on White's leadership amidst ongoing controversies.
